Persicaria vivipara, a perennial herbaceous flowering plant in the knotweed and buckwheat family Polygonaceae, common all over the high Arctic, Small flowers are white or pink, Lower ones are replaced by bulbs. Flowers rarely produce viable seeds, 2014
